MARK ERELLI

– Delivered

2008-10-06

Erelli reveals personal lyrics over simple, catchy melodies that address politics & Iraq ("Volunteers," "Shadowland," "Hope Dies Last"), driving along the east coast ("Baltimore," "Five Beer Moon"), and love ("Not Alone," "Delivered," "Once"). -Jon Lewandowski
